When a patient presents to a clinician, it is vitally important for the doctor to be able to differentiate quickly and correctly between the various diseases to which the presenting symptoms may be attributed. This book provides the reader with invaluable assistance in this diagnostic process. Arranged alphabetically, and based upon presenting symptoms, the text takes the reader through a step-by-step approach to that presentation, culminating in a description of the different diagnoses that it might represent. Symptoms and signs are illustrated in full colour, and the potential diagnoses are listed in order of importance. The book also contains a series of useful appendices, including definitions, reference ranges, lab values, tumour staging and obstetric measurements, amongst others. Differential Diagnosis in Obstetrics and Gynaecology is an invaluable ready-reference guide and revision aid for the student and trainee, and will also be of value to GPs, A & E personnel, gynaecology nurses and midwives.

This new pocket guide will be an ideal resource in everyday obstetric and gynaecology practice and a must for exam preparation. Rapid Obstetrics and Gynaecology is the third title in the new Rapid series and is the ideal companion for clinical students working on their Obs & Gynae attachments. It provides quick access to information on the common obstetric and gynaecological diseases and problems that they will encounter on the wards, in clinics, and in their exams. Arranged in A-Z format, each condition is covered using the same headings - Definition, Aetiology, Associations/Risk Factors, Epidemiology, History, Examination, Pathology, Investigations, Management, Complications, Prognosis and Differential Diagnosis. There are also further sections on procedures and general obstetric and gynaecology management. Rapid Obstetrics and Gynaecology is authored by four medical students from the Royal Free and University College Medical School, London, and the University of Liverpool School of Medicine. Two senior clinicians, Professor Allen MacLean and Mr Paul Hardiman at the Royal Free, are the Editorial Advisors, and Amir H. Sam, is the Series Editor.

Excerpt from Differential Diagnosis: Presented Through an Analysis of 383 Cases Cases of disease present, as we say, certain leading symptoms. They thrust forward, like a soldier who presents arms, a complaint such as pain, cough, or nervousness, so that it occupies the foreground of the clinical picture. Such a presenting symptom, comparable to the presenting par in obstetrics, may turn out to be of minor im portance when we have studied the whole case. But at the outset it has the power to lead us toward right or wrong conclusions in diagnosis, prognosis, and treatment, according as we have or have not learned the art of following it up. This book is an attempt to study medicine from the point of view of the presenting symptom. I hope to show how the complaints of the patient - fragmentary expressions of the underlying disease - should be used as leads, and how their lead can be followed to the actual seat of the disease. The revised, updated Fifth Edition of this pocket book is a handy reference to consult when making bedside interpretations of clinical data. Remarkably complete for its small size, the book lists nearly 200 symptoms, physical signs, laboratory test results, and radiologic findings and their differential diagnoses. This edition has a new, more user-friendly two-color design, tabs indicating sections, and shortened lists of the most common diagnoses. An expanded section on HIV infection covers new manifestations, including immune reconstitution syndrome. The infectious disease chapter has been revised to reflect its increasing importance in clinical medicine, the emergence of multi-drug resistant bacteria, and the threat of bioterrorism.
